Nadal fan. I had Djokovic as favorite based on his form throughout the year, versus Nadal's botched preparation and Rome woes.

I also thought the slow conditions would help Djokovic as they did in 2012.

I decided not to give much mind to their performance against inferior players in the same tournament, since that's been a poor indicator with those two in the past.

I had it pegged as a close match. Thought Djokovic might win by attrition. If Nadal won, I expected it to be a relatively quick blitz (which it was).

To me, results from most to least likely to me were Djokovic in 4-5, Nadal in 3-4, Nadal in 5, Djokovic in 3.
